本文目录导读:
随着信息技术的飞速发展,云计算已成为当今世界最具影响力的技术之一,而作为云计算基础架构的核心,虚拟化技术发挥着至关重要的作用,本文将深入探讨虚拟化技术的内涵、应用以及未来发展趋势。
虚拟化技术的内涵
虚拟化技术,顾名思义,就是将物理资源虚拟化为多个逻辑资源的过程,通过虚拟化,我们可以将一台物理服务器分割成多个虚拟机(VM),每个虚拟机都可以独立运行操作系统和应用程序,虚拟化技术主要包括以下几种类型:
1、硬件虚拟化:通过在物理服务器上安装虚拟化软件,实现硬件资源的虚拟化,常见的硬件虚拟化技术有VMware、Xen、KVM等。
2、软件虚拟化:通过在操作系统层面实现虚拟化,如Docker、LXC等。
图片来源于网络,如有侵权联系删除
3、网络虚拟化:将物理网络设备虚拟化为多个逻辑网络设备,实现网络资源的灵活分配和隔离。
4、存储虚拟化:将物理存储设备虚拟化为多个逻辑存储设备,实现存储资源的弹性扩展和优化。
虚拟化技术的应用
虚拟化技术在云计算领域有着广泛的应用,以下列举几个典型场景:
1、服务器虚拟化:通过服务器虚拟化,可以降低服务器数量,提高资源利用率,降低能耗和运维成本。
2、容器虚拟化:容器虚拟化技术如Docker,可以实现应用程序的快速部署、扩展和迁移,提高开发效率。
图片来源于网络,如有侵权联系删除
3、网络虚拟化:通过网络虚拟化,可以实现网络资源的灵活配置和隔离,满足不同业务需求。
4、存储虚拟化:存储虚拟化技术可以简化存储管理,提高存储资源利用率,降低存储成本。
虚拟化技术的未来发展趋势
1、虚拟化技术的融合:虚拟化技术将与其他技术如人工智能、大数据等进行融合,实现更智能、高效的应用。
2、虚拟化技术的开放性:随着云计算的普及,虚拟化技术将更加注重开放性,支持更多平台和操作系统的兼容。
3、虚拟化技术的安全性:随着虚拟化技术的广泛应用,安全性问题将愈发突出,虚拟化技术将更加注重安全防护,提高系统稳定性。
图片来源于网络,如有侵权联系删除
4、虚拟化技术的绿色化:随着环保意识的增强,虚拟化技术将更加注重节能减排,降低能耗。
虚拟化技术作为云计算基础架构的核心,在推动云计算发展过程中发挥着不可替代的作用,随着虚拟化技术的不断发展和创新,我们将见证云计算领域的更多精彩。
标签: #虚拟化技术是云计算基础
评论列表